U.S. Air Force Staff Sgt. Wesley Zech, left, and Senior Airman Tyler Williams, right, loadmasters assigned to the 36th Airlift Squadron, Yokota Air Force Base, Japan, load cargo onto a C-130J Super Hercules assigned to the 36th Airlift Squadron, Yokota Air Base, Japan, during RED FLAG-Alaska 22-2 at Joint Base Elmendorf-Richardson, Alaska, June 20, 2022. This exercise provides unique opportunities to integrate various forces into joint, coalition and multilateral training from simulated forward operating bases.
